Condividi tramite

Powershell e cmd si chiudono immediatamente

Anonimo
2024-03-19T13:32:45+00:00

Salve,

come si può eliminare il problema di powershell e cmd che dopo averli aperti non in modalità admin,, si chiudono immediatamente, mentre in modalità admin funziona senza errori?

Nome dell'applicazione che ha generato l'errore: pwsh.exe, versione: 7.4.1.500, timestamp: 0x65680000

Nome del modulo che ha generato l'errore: Microsoft.PowerShell.ConsoleHost.dll, versione: 7.4.1.500, timestamp: 0x80f778d3

Codice eccezione: 0x80131623

Offset errore 0x000000000004de0d

ID processo che ha generato l'errore: 0x0x1700

Ora di avvio dell'applicazione che ha generato l'errore: 0x0x1DA79FFE18F51BA

Percorso dell'applicazione che ha generato l'errore: C:\Program Files\WindowsApps\Microsoft.PowerShell_7.4.1.0_x64__8wekyb3d8bbwe\pwsh.exe

Percorso del modulo che ha generato l'errore: C:\Program Files\WindowsApps\Microsoft.PowerShell_7.4.1.0_x64__8wekyb3d8bbwe\Microsoft.PowerShell.ConsoleHost.dll

ID segnalazione: b72d967b-0db7-446d-aae5-06727e03a9dc

Nome completo pacchetto che ha generato l'errore: Microsoft.PowerShell_7.4.1.0_x64__8wekyb3d8bbwe

Application: pwsh.exe

CoreCLR Version: 8.0.123.58001

.NET Version: 8.0.1

Description: The application requested process termination through System.Environment.FailFast.

Message: The Win32 internal error "Nessun altro processo all'altra estremità della pipe." 0xE9 occurred while getting console output buffer information. Contact Microsoft Customer Support Services.

Description: The process was terminated due to an unhandled exception.System.Management.Automation.Host.HostException: The Win32 internal error "Nessun altro processo all'altra estremità della pipe." 0xE9 occurred while getting console output buffer information. Contact Microsoft Customer Support Services.

 ---> System.ComponentModel.Win32Exception (233): Nessun altro processo all'altra estremità della pipe.

   --- End of inner exception stack trace ---

   at Microsoft.PowerShell.ConsoleControl.GetConsoleScreenBufferInfo(SafeFileHandle consoleHandle)

   at Microsoft.PowerShell.ConsoleHostRawUserInterface.get_CursorPosition()

   at Microsoft.PowerShell.ConsoleHost.InputLoop.Run(Boolean inputLoopIsNested)

   at Microsoft.PowerShell.ConsoleHost.InputLoop.RunNewInputLoop(ConsoleHost parent, Boolean isNested)

   at Microsoft.PowerShell.ConsoleHost.EnterNestedPrompt()

   at Microsoft.PowerShell.ConsoleHost.DoRunspaceLoop(String initialCommand, Boolean skipProfiles, Collection`1 initialCommandArgs, Boolean staMode, String configurationName, String configurationFilePath)

   at Microsoft.PowerShell.ConsoleHost.Run(CommandLineParameterParser cpp, Boolean isPrestartWarned)

   at Microsoft.PowerShell.ConsoleHost.Start(String bannerText, String helpText, Boolean issProvidedExternally)

   at Microsoft.PowerShell.UnmanagedPSEntry.Start(String[] args, Int32 argc)

Stack:

   at System.Environment.FailFast(System.String, System.Exception)

   at Microsoft.PowerShell.UnmanagedPSEntry.Start(System.String[], Int32)

   at Microsoft.PowerShell.ManagedPSEntry.Main(System.String[])

Nome del modulo che ha generato l'errore: OpenConsole.exe, versione: 1.19.2402.26003, timestamp: 0x65dce3b6

Codice eccezione: 0xc000001d

Offset errore 0x000000000001d650

ID processo che ha generato l'errore: 0x0x1C88

Ora di avvio dell'applicazione che ha generato l'errore: 0x0x1DA7AB98038DB0F

Percorso dell'applicazione che ha generato l'errore: C:\Program Files\WindowsApps\Microsoft.WindowsTerminal_1.19.10573.0_x64__8wekyb3d8bbwe\OpenConsole.exe

Percorso del modulo che ha generato l'errore: C:\Program Files\WindowsApps\Microsoft.WindowsTerminal_1.19.10573.0_x64__8wekyb3d8bbwe\OpenConsole.exe

ID segnalazione: 689f679d-3194-4cf6-b1d0-d69e178457f3

Nome completo pacchetto che ha generato l'errore: Microsoft.WindowsTerminal_1.19.10573.0_x64__8wekyb3d8bbwe

Windows per utenti privati | Windows 11 | Prestazioni ed errori di sistema

Domanda bloccata. Questa domanda è stata eseguita dalla community del supporto tecnico Microsoft. È possibile votare se è utile, ma non è possibile aggiungere commenti o risposte o seguire la domanda.

0 commenti Nessun commento

Risposta accettata dall'autore della domanda

Emmanuel Santana 39,725 Punti di reputazione Consulente indipendente
2024-03-21T11:40:25+00:00

Ecco un modo molto astuto per installarlo. Sono sicuramente contento che hai trovato una soluzione del genere. Non esitare a tornare se incontri ulteriori domande o preoccupazioni. Sono qui per aiutarti. Buona giornata!

La risposta è stata utile?

1 persona ha trovato utile questa risposta.
0 commenti Nessun commento

10 risposte aggiuntive

Ordina per: Più utili
  1. Anonimo
    2024-03-19T19:03:39+00:00

    Ho provato con un nuovo profilo admin, ma presenta lo stesso problema...

    Mi sai dare la procedura per cancellare il nuovo profilo e tutti i relativi file, visto che rimangono.

    grazie

    La risposta è stata utile?

    0 commenti Nessun commento
  2. Emmanuel Santana 39,725 Punti di reputazione Consulente indipendente
    2024-03-19T17:59:16+00:00

    Grazie per il tuo seguito. Proviamo altre due cose. Innanzitutto, ti suggerisco di creare un nuovo account utente con privilegi amministrativi su Windows. Accedi con questo nuovo account e controlla se PowerShell/CMD si aprono senza problemi. Se lo fanno, è probabile che il tuo profilo utente originale sia corrotto.

    La risposta è stata utile?

    0 commenti Nessun commento
  3. Anonimo
    2024-03-19T17:52:38+00:00

    Già fatto, grazie ma persiste.

    La risposta è stata utile?

    0 commenti Nessun commento
  4. Emmanuel Santana 39,725 Punti di reputazione Consulente indipendente
    2024-03-19T17:50:02+00:00

    Ciao, grazie per aver contattato la Community di Microsoft. Sono qui per aiutarti e fornire assistenza con qualsiasi domanda o problema tu possa avere.

    Quali passaggi di risoluzione dei problemi hai provato finora? Puoi provare a eseguire alcuni comandi nel Prompt dei comandi, in questo caso, i comandi devono essere eseguiti con il Prompt dei comandi con permessi di amministratore.

    1. Cerca "Prompt dei comandi" o "PowerShell" nel menu Start.
    2. Fai clic con il pulsante destro sull'icona appropriata e seleziona "Esegui come amministratore".

    Dopo questo, esegui questi comandi:

    DISM /Online /Cleanup-Image /CheckHealth

    DISM /Online /Cleanup-Image /ScanHealth

    DISM /Online /Cleanup-Image /RestoreHealth

    sfc /scannow

    Dopo aver eseguito DISM e SFC, riavvia il computer e verifica se il problema persiste.

    La risposta è stata utile?

    0 commenti Nessun commento